Ohio counties eligible for Local Assistance and Tribal Consistency Funds

On September 29, the U.S. Department of the Treasury began releasing the first round of Local Assistance and Tribal Consistency Fund (LATCF) payments, providing $1.5 billion to 2,086 “eligible revenue sharing counties” under the American Rescue Plan Act. These are predominantly counties with federal public lands.

Fifty-two Ohio counties are eligible for these funds. These counties can be seen in the map below and are displayed, along with their appropriations under LATCF, in this document.

Counties have until January 31, 2023 to apply, otherwise, they forfeit both payments. NACo worked closely with Treasury to make sure that this program provided payments to counties consistent with Congressional intent, and so we want to make sure every eligible county gets the funding from this program that they deserve. To receive payments, counties can log into the Treasury Department’s portal.
